COVID-19's impact on mobile
robotics growth
The COVID-19 pandemic is
creating the opportunity for mobile robotsto be used for various markets and
could lead to a reassessment of supply chains in the future.
Gregory Hale
Coronavirus has highlighted
use cases for mobile robotics to successfully disinfect, monitor, look over,
handle, and deliver materiais to the point where the market will grow to $23
billion by 2021, new research showed.
“Crises shift perceptions
on what is possible regarding investment and transformative action on the part
of both private and government actors,” said Rian Whitton, sênior analyst at
tech market advisory firm, ABI Research. “By the time the COVID-19 pandemic has
passed, robots will be mainstreamed across a range of applications and
markets.”
Mobile robots
on display
The virus has been a good
opportunity for companies to display robots for public applications.
One of the more popular
applications has been deploying mobile unmanned platforms with Uitravioiet (UV)
light to disinfect facilities. Danish company UVD Robots is reaping the
benefits of this opportunity and is scaling up deployments of robots to
disinfect hospitais.
U.S.-based Germ Falcon is
offering a similar UV disinfection solution for aircraft, while Chinese TMiRob
is deploying disinfection robots in Wuhan.
“Automating disinfection is
a key part of maintaining health and safety and could be one of the major
bright spots in the response to COVID-19,” Whitton said.
Drones have also been
deployed to enforce curfews and surveil areas for security purposes.
Short-and long-term
opportunities
This represents a big
opportunity for aerospace and drone companies to increase sales to government
agencies. ABI Research expects the small drone delivery market to reach $414
million by 2021 and $10.4 billion by 2030.
In the short term, to
enforce quarantine mandates, governments will need to increase their security
apparatuses, as well as the productivity of their medicai agencies. Robots will
be key to achieving that through disinfection, monitoring, and surveillance.
Furthermore, the shutting down of households and even ships represents a chance
for robot delivery companies (for both land and air) to display their worth.
The drone delivery market could take its experience with transporting supplies
in the developing world and scale up their operations in the most affected
countries.
Long-term, COVID-19 is
leading to a significant reassessment of the global manufacturing supply Chain.
America’s dependence on Chinese imports for basic equipment and medicines is
becoming a contentious issue, and government representatives are already
interpreting the crisis as a chance to revitalize the campaign to bring more
manufacturing capacity to the domestic market. If this translates into more
significant measures by governments to diversify or bringing back the
manufacturing of key goods, this could bode very well for the robotics
industry, as such changes would require big increases in CAPEX and productivity
improvements within developed countries.
COVID-19 represents a
disaster for robotics vendors building Solutions for developed markets in
manufacturing, industry, and the supply chain. But for vendors targeting
markets closerto government, such as health, security, and defense, it
represents a big opportunity.
Whitton said, “Industrial
players develop customized Solutions for non-manufacturíng use cases or look to
build comprehensive Solutions for enabling a scale-up in medicai supply
manufacturing. For mobile robotics vendors and software companies targeting
more nascent markets, this represents a big chance to highlight the importance
of robotics for dealing with national emergencies, as well as mitigating the
economic shock.”

Mathematical Modeling of
Epidemie Diseases; A Case Study of the COVID-19 Coronavirus
Reza Sameni
Abstract—The
outbreak of the Coronavirus COVID-19 has taken the lives of several thousands
worldwide and lockedout many countries and regions, with yet unpredictable
global consequences. In this research we study the epidemic patterns of this
virus, from a mathematical modeling perspective. The study is based on an
extension of the well-known susceptible-infectedrecovered (SIR) family of
compartmental models. It is shown how social measures such as distancing,
regional lockdowns, quarantine and global public health vigilance influence the
model parameters, which can eventually change the mortality rates and active
contaminated cases over time, in the real world. As with all mathematical
models, the predictive ability of the model is limited by the accuracy of the
available data and to the so-called levei of abstraction used for modeling the
problem. In order to provide the broader audience of researchers a better
understanding of spreading patterns of epidemic diseases, a short introduction
on biological systems modeling is also presented and the Matlab source codes
for the simulations are provided online.
I. Introduction
Since the outbreak of the
Coronavirus COVID-19 in January 2020, the virus has affected most countries and
taken the lives of several thousands of people worldwide. By March 2020, the
World Health Organization (WHO) declared the situation a pandemic, the first of
its kind in our generation. To date, many countries and regions have been
locked-down and applied strict social distancing measures to stop the virus
propagation. From a strategic and healthcare management perspective, the
propagation pattern of the disease and the prediction of its spread over time
is of great importance to save lives and to minimize the social and economic
consequences of the disease. Within the scientific community, the problem of
interest has been studied in various communities including mathematical
epidemiology, biological systems modeling, signal Processing and control
engineering.
In this study, epidemic
outbreaks are studied from an interdisciplinary perspective, by using an
extension of the susceptibleexposed-infected-recovered (SEIR) model, which is a
mathematical compartmental model based on the average behavior of a population
under study. The objective is to provide researchers a better understanding of
the significance of mathematical modeling for epidemic diseases. It is shown by
simulation how social measures such as distancing, regional lockdowns and
public health vigilance can influence the model parameters, which in turn
change the mortality rates and active contaminated cases over time.
It should be highlighted
that mathematical models applied to real-world systems (social, biological,
economical, etc.) are only valid under their assumptions and hypothesis.
Therefore, this research—and similar ones—that address epidemic patterns do not
convey direct clinicai information and dangers for the public, but they should
rather be used by healthcare strategists for better planning and decision
making. Hence, the study of this work is only recommended for researchers
familiar with the strength points and limitations of mathematical modeling of
biological systems. The Matlab codes required for reproducing the results of
this research are also online available in the Git repository of the project.
In Section II, a brief introduction to mathematical modeling of biological systems is presented
to highlight the scope of the present study and to open perspectives for the
interested researchers, who may be less familiar with the context. The proposed
model for the outspread of the Coronavirus is presented in Section III. The
article is concluded with some general remarks and future perspectives.

Mathematical modeling of
the spread of the coronavirus disease 2019 (COVID-19) taking into account the
undetected infections. The case of China.
B. Ivorra, M. R. Ferrández,
M. Vela-Pérez
and A. M. Ramosa
Abstract
In this paper we develop a
mathematical model for the spread of the coronavirus disease 2019 (COVID-19).
It is a new 0-SEIHRD model (not a SIR, SEIR or other general purpose model),
which takes into account the known special characteristics of this disease, as
the existence of infectious undetected cases and the different sanitary and
infectiousness conditions of hospitalized people. In particular, it includes a
novel approach that considers the fraction 0 of detected cases over the real
total infected cases, which allows to study the importance of this ratio on the
impact of COVID-19. The model is also able to estimate the needs of beds in
hospitais. It is complex enough to capture the most important effects, but also
simple enough to allow an affordable identification of its parameters, using
the data that authorities report on this pandemic.
We study the particular
case of China (including Chinese Mainland, Macao, Hong-Kong and Taiwan, as done
by the World Health Organization in its reports on COVID-19), and use its
reported data to identify the model parameters, which can be of interest for
estimating the spread of COVID-19 in other countries. We show a good agreement
between the reported data and the estimations given by our model. We also study
the behavior of the outputs returned by our model when considering incomplete
reported data (by truncating them at some dates before and after the peak of
daily reported cases). By comparing those results, we can estimate the error
produced by the model when identifying the parameters at early stages of the
pandemic. Finally, taking into account the advantages of the novelties
introduced by our model, we study different scenarios to show how different
values of the percentage of detected cases would have changed the global
magnitude of COVID-19 in China, which can be of interest for policy makers.
Keywords:
Mathematical model, 6-SEIHRD model, COVID-19, Coronavirus, SARS-CoV-2,
Pandemic, Numerical simulation, Parameter estimation
1. Introduction
Modeling and simulation are
important decision tools that can be useful to control human and animal
diseases. However, since each disease exhibits its own particular biological
characteristics, the models need to be adapted to each specific case in orderto
be able to tackle real situations.
Coronavirus disease 2019
(COVID-19) is an infectious disease emerging in China in December 2019 that has
rapidly spread around China and many other countries. On 11 February 2020, the
World Health Organization (WHO) renamed the epidemic disease caused by
2019-nCoV as strain severe acute respiratory syndrome coronavirus 2
(SARSCoV-2).
This is a new virus and a
completely new situation. On 30 January 2020, WHO declared it to be a Public
Health Emergency of International Concern. As of 11 March 2020, the disease was
confirmed in more than 118,000 cases reported globally in 114 18 countries,
more than 90 percent of cases are in just four countries (two of those China
and the Republic of Korea - have significantly declining epidemics) and WHO
declared it to be a pandemic, the first one caused by a coronavirus. On 1 April
2020 there are 872,481 and 43,275 official reported cases and deaths,
respectively, and there is no vaccine specifically designed for this virus,
with proven effectiveness.
There are some mathematical
models in the literature that try to describe the dynamics of the evolution of
COVID-19. (...) Other works, propose SEIR type models with little variations
and some of them incorporate stochastic components. COVID-19 is a disease
caused by a new virus, which is generating a worldwide emergency situation and needs a model taking
into account its known specific characteristics.
